Latest Patents

Anton Ziebig holds a patent for an extrusion device designed for the production of honeycomb structures. This device features a die part supported on a stationary part, equipped with feed passageways for plastic material on the inlet side. The shaping slots on the outlet side communicate with these feed passageways. The die passageway for the skin of the honeycomb structure is formed through the interaction of an adjustable die element with the die part on the outlet side. Additionally, adjustable means are arranged in the feeds of the die passageway to regulate the flow rate of the plastic material. He has 1 patent to his name.
